Output 0679358362eedd8551bc625fc6718a913e84830be30a7fc0ffc0da57a6c3140e:15

value
26208522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4092e893ab5b6ed12de1bcf91ce4479ba404d6b4 OP_EQUAL
address
MDnbU67wti5tN2LpqkPLsKwA7CzFmRqimx
transaction
0679358362eedd8551bc625fc6718a913e84830be30a7fc0ffc0da57a6c3140e
spent
true